Angela, a clinical instructor is conducting a lecture about chemotherapy. Which of the following statements is correct about the rate of cell growth in relation to chemotherapy?
A. Faster growing cells are more susceptible to chemotherapy
B. Faster growing cells are less susceptible to chemotherapy
C. Slower growing cells are more susceptible to chemotherapy
D. Non-dividing cells are more susceptible to chemotherapy
Correct Answer: A. Faster growing cells are more susceptible to chemotherapy
Option A: The faster the cell grows, the more susceptible it is to chemotherapy and radiation therapy.
Options B, C, and D: Slow-growing and non-dividing cells are less susceptible to chemotherapy. Repeated cycles of chemotherapy are used to destroy nondividing cells as they begin active cell division.
